規格

屬性 價值
Package Tray
Series LPC43xx
ProductStatus Active
CoreProcessor ARM® Cortex®-M4/M0
CoreSize 32-Bit Dual-Core
Speed 204MHz
Connectivity CANbus, EBI/EMI, Ethernet, I²C, IrDA, Microwire, QEI, SD, SPI, SSI, SSP, UART/USART, USB, USB OTG
Peripherals Brown-out Detect/Reset, DMA, I²S, POR, WDT
NumberofI/O 164
ProgramMemorySize 1MB (1M x 8)
ProgramMemoryType FLASH
EEPROMSize 16K x 8
RAMSize 136K x 8
Voltage-Supply(Vcc/Vdd) 2.4V ~ 3.6V
DataConverters A/D 8x10b SAR; D/A 1x10b
OscillatorType Internal
OperatingTemperature -40°C ~ 85°C (TA)
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case 256-LBGA

Features

The LPC4357FET256K is a high-performance microcontroller from NXP's LPC4000 series, featuring a dual-core architecture with an ARM Cortex-M4 and a Cortex-M0 processor. Key features include:
1. Memory: It has 1 MB of Flash memory and 136 KB of SRAM, providing ample storage for code and data.
2. Speed: The Cortex-M4 core operates at speeds up to 204 MHz, delivering fast processing capabilities.
3. Peripherals: This microcontroller supports a rich set of peripherals, including USB 2.0 Host/Device/OTG with on-chip PHY, Ethernet, LCD, CAN, and multiple UART, SPI, and I2C interfaces.
4. Analog Features: It includes a 10-bit ADC and DAC for analog-to-digital and digital-to-analog conversions.
5. Timers and PWM: There are multiple 32-bit timers, a state configurable timer (SCT), and PWM outputs for precise time and waveform generation.
6. Security: Features like AES encryption ensure data security.
7. GPIO: It offers a wide array of general-purpose I/O pins for diverse interfacing needs.
The LPC4357FET256K is ideal for applications requiring robust processing power and connectivity, such as industrial control, communication systems, and advanced consumer electronics.
